KUWAIT CITY, Aug 24: The Samsung Galaxy Z Fold 8 is an ideal choice for multitaskers, content enthusiasts, and productivity-focused users who want a premium foldable that combines portability with a tablet-sized experience.

The cutting-edge passport-size foldable smartphone with a large, high-quality AMOLED display and robust battery life. This device excels in portability, design, AI-powered software features, and camera performance, offering a near-flagship experience. Weighing just 201 grams, it offers a lighter and shorter form factor compared to predecessors, making pocketing and one-handed use more comfortable. Its dual display setup includes a wide 5.5-inch cover screen ideal for messaging and browsing, and a tablet-shaped 7.6-inch internal display optimized for reading, multitasking, and gaming. The device features Samsung’s advanced materials such as an armor aluminum frame, Gorilla Glass ceramic front, and Victus 2 rear for durability, along with IP48 dust and water resistance.

To keep it short, it is a highly functional and innovative device, especially appealing to those who appreciate multitasking and content consumption on a large foldable screen.

Performance powered by Qualcomm’s Snapdragon 8 Gen 2 for Galaxy is smooth for daily use but struggles with thermal throttling in heavy gaming scenarios. Battery life has improved from previous models with a 4800 mAh cell, capable of lasting an entire day with varied use. The camera system is a dual 50 MP setup (primary and ultra-wide) without telephoto, which performs well in good light. Video and audio features are solid, with support for 8K recording and stereo speakers, though stereo sound is lost when unfolded.

Overall, the Z Fold 8 offers a significant step forward in foldable design and usability, particularly through its enhanced cover screen and robust build quality, making it a compelling choice despite some limitations in gaming, battery endurance, and camera flexibility. Its premium price remains a barrier, but current promotions slightly soften the cost.

Compact Form Factor Enables Better Portability: When folded, the phone resembles a compact passport-sized device that fits comfortably in hand and pocket, aided by its thinness and lightweight 201 g frame. Opening it reveals a vibrant 7.1-inch AMOLED display with a 120 Hz refresh rate, providing an immersive media consumption experience. The design successfully marries convenience with a premium large-screen viewing. The Z Fold 8’s reduced height and weight relative to previous Fold models allow it to fit comfortably in pockets without protruding, addressing a key pain point for foldable smartphones and enhancing everyday carry convenience.

The crease on the folding inner display remains visible, albeit reduced in prominence from prior generations. Durability concerns remain as testing shows the titanium screen protector can be scratched easily by fingernails, which may cause user apprehension over everyday handling and long-term wear.

 Cover Screen’s Wider 16:10 Aspect Ratio Enhances Usability: Unlike typical tall and narrow foldable cover screens, the Z Fold 8’s wider cover display facilitates better typing and app use without requiring constant unfolding. This makes it a practical device for quick interactions, messaging, and media consumption on the go.

Internal Display’s Tablet Form Factor Supports Multitasking and Reading: The 7.6-inch 4:3 aspect ratio mimics a traditional tablet, providing a natural experience for reading graphic novels, browsing, and running side-by-side apps. Samsung’s multitasking UI lets users run up to three apps simultaneously, optimizing productivity on a phone-sized device.

Gemini AI Delivers Practical, User-Friendly Features:  Samsung’s inclusion of AI-powered utilities, branded as Gemini, empowers users with advanced features such as automated answering of unknown calls to screen for scams, and smart video cropping that reorients landscape videos for portrait platforms like TikTok without reshooting. These tools highlight how AI integration can streamline everyday smartphone tasks, making the Fold 8 stand out beyond hardware alone.

 Thermal Constraints Limit Peak Gaming Performance: Although equipped with flagship Snapdragon 8 Gen 2 for Galaxy, the Z Fold 8’s compact chassis lacks advanced cooling (no large vapor chamber), causing overheating and jitter in demanding games like Wuthering Waves after 10-15 minutes, forcing users to lower graphics settings for smooth gameplay.

Battery Capacity and Efficiency Show Notable Improvement: Upgraded from 4400 mAh to 4800 mAh, the battery supports over 18 hours of mixed use in a day involving camera, video streaming, and mobile network activity. While better than previous Fold models, it still trails some competitors, but the support for 45W wired and 20W wireless charging helps maintain usability.

 Camera Setup Offers Quality for Everyday: The dual 50 MP main and ultra-wide sensors empower sharp, vibrant photos and decent low light performance but absence of telephoto on digital zoom capped at 10x, degrading image quality at longer zoom levels. Night scenes especially suffer from noise and soft detail. The Fold 8’s camera delivers highly competitive photos and videos with strong resolution and quality. The foldable design doubles as a flexible portable webcam, enabling new workflows for desktop use and creative group photo taking with preview screens. This multi-functionality leverages the fold form factor innovatively.

Video Capabilities Are Versatile: The phone supports up to 8K video recording and 4K60 HDR on both main cameras, with good stabilization and clear audio. Video recording performs admirably under proper lighting conditions, though results may vary in dimmer environments. Adequate lighting is suggested to maximize quality.
